From: Andrea Parri <[email protected]> We now have a shiny new Linux-kernel memory model (LKMM) and the old tried-and-true Documentation/memory-barrier.txt. It would be good to keep these automatically synchronized, but in the meantime we need at least let people know that they are related. Will suggested adding the Documentation/memory-barrier.txt file to the LKMM maintainership list, thus making the LKMM maintainers responsible for both the old and the new. This commit follows Will's excellent suggestion.
